The Malaysia Industrial Coatings Market was estimated at USD 222 Million in 2025 and is projected to reach USD 290 Million by 2032, growing at a CAGR of 3.9% from 2026 to 2032. This trajectory is fueled by the accelerating pace of industrialization and infrastructure projects, which are key drivers of demand for protective coatings in various sectors. As Malaysia enhances its manufacturing capabilities and invests in sustainable solutions, the industrial coatings sector is poised to thrive.

The industrial coatings market in Malaysia is experiencing a pivotal moment, heavily influenced by growth in manufacturing and construction activities. As industries recover and expand post-pandemic, the need for durable and environmentally responsible coatings has become a priority.
With ongoing infrastructure investments and an increasing focus on sustainability, manufacturers are adapting their product offerings. Innovations in eco-friendly and high-performance coatings are reshaping market dynamics, driving companies to align with evolving customer expectations.
The Malaysia Industrial Coatings Market faces specific challenges that may hinder its growth trajectory. A significant restraint is the necessity for customized coating solutions across various sectors, compelling manufacturers to allocate substantial resources toward research and development. Additionally, the increasing focus on sustainability complicates the production landscape, as companies must adapt formulations to meet eco-friendly standards while retaining performance. Balancing customization and sustainability remains a crucial challenge for industry players.
A notable trend in the Malaysia Industrial Coatings Market is the growing preference for environmentally friendly coatings, driven by both regulatory pressures and consumer demand. The rise of smart coatings that provide additional functionalities, such as self-cleaning and anti-corrosion properties, is also becoming prominent. Innovations in water-based and low-VOC formulations are reshaping production methods and aligning with sustainability goals, offering companies an opportunity to differentiate their products in a competitive landscape.
The market presents genuine growth opportunities as industries adapt to modernization and sustainability demands. Expanding infrastructure projects—spanning transportation, healthcare, and urban development—require innovative coating solutions that extend asset longevity. Additionally, the push towards digitalization within manufacturing presents possibilities for smart coating technologies, allowing companies to invest in R&D that caters to the evolving needs of their clients.
The Malaysian government has initiated various programs aimed at boosting industrial growth and sustainability. These include investments in infrastructure development and incentives for companies adopting eco-friendly practices. Regulatory frameworks are increasingly promoting the use of low-VOC and water-based coatings, encouraging manufacturers to align with global sustainability benchmarks. Such initiatives create a conducive environment for the industrial coatings market to flourish.
